Thayer's Greek Lexicon
πλάνος, πλανον, wandering, roving; transitively and tropically, misleading, leading into error: πνεύματα πλανᾷ, 1Ti_4:1 (πλάνοι ἄνθρωποι, Josephus, b. j. 2, 13, 4). ὁ πλάνος substantively (Cicero, others,planus), as we say, a vagabond, 'tramp,' impostor (Diodorus, Athen., others); hence, universally, a corrupter, deceiver, (Vulg.seductor): Mat_27:63; 2Co_6:8; 2Jn_1:7. (Cf. ὁ κοσμοπλάνος, 'Teaching' etc. 16, 4 [ET].)

Abbott-Smith Greek Lexicon
πλάνος , -ον ,
[in LXX : Job_19:4 ( H4879 ), Jer_23:32 * ;]
1. wandering .
2. leading astray, deceiving: πνεύματα Papyri, 1Ti_4:1 . As subst ., ὁ Papyri, a deceiver, impostor: Mat_27:63 , 2Co_6:8 ; 2Co_6:1-18 :2Jn_1:7 .†

Liddell-Scott — Intermediate Greek Lexicon
πλάνος πλά^νος, ον, act. "leading astray, cheating, deceiving", Theocr. , Mosch. πλάνος, ῀ πλάνη, "a wandering, roaming, straying", Soph. , Eur. , etc. metaph., φροντίδος πλάνοι "the wanderings" of thought, Soph. ; but, πλ. φρενῶν "wandering" of mind, madness, Eur. ; πλάνοις "in uncertain fits", of a disease, Soph. ; κερκίδος πλάνοι, of the act of weaving, Eur. of persons, πλάνος, "a deceiver, impostor", NTest.
